Publix Super Markets on Wednesday announced plans to open a new store in Ashland Square in mid-Prince William County.

The new grocery store will be Northern Virginia’s first Publix, not counting the supermarket that opened in North Stafford in 2020.

In a brief news release, Publix said there is no opening date yet for the new store at the northwest corner of Dumfries and Spriggs roads in Ashland Square. The store lists a Manassas address but is geographically closer to Montclair and Dale City.
